Jerky has a lot of benefits.  According to the USDA’s food safety information about beef jerky:

This product is a nutrient-dense meat that has been made lightweight by drying…. Because most of the moisture is removed, it is shelf stable — can be stored without refrigeration — making it a handy food for backpackers and others who don’t have access to refrigerators.

In fact, it’s so nutritious and convenient that beef jerky is one of the foods that NASA provides for astronauts on the space station!

Chomps Snack Sticks (gochomps.com) were created in 2012 as a health food.  Their beef jerky sticks are made with 100% Non-GMO Grass-Fed Angus Beef that is sourced from New Zealand. They contain no artificial ingredients (no nitrites, nitrates, MSG, colors, flavors), and they are shelf stable for a year with the help of celery juice.

Chomps Snack Sticks

Chomps Snack Sticks are available in three flavors:  Original, Crankin’ Cran, and Hoppin’ Jalapeno.

Per the Chomps website, the ingredients in the original flavor sticks are: 100% Grass-Fed Beef, Water, Salt, Citric Acid, Celery Juice, Black Pepper, Red Pepper, Garlic Powder, Coriander, Stuffed in a Collagen Casing.

The Chomps sticks compare to a Slim Jim giant stick, but are healthier.  I looked up the Slim Jim giant sticks original flavor for comparison.  The Slim Jim serving size is a 28g stick, which is .99 ounces (a marginally smaller serving size than the Chomps stick).  The Slim Jim giant stick has 140 calories, 11g fat, 6g protein, 25mg cholesterol, 480mg sodium, and 4g carbohydrates.

In comparison, the Chomps web site lists the nutrition facts for the original flavor one-ounce stick as: 100 calories, 6g fat, 9g protein, 20mg cholesterol, 250mg sodium, and zero carbohydrates/sugars.
